Hvordan fikse “Fatal feil arduinoble.h ingen slik fil eller katalog ”i Arduino -programmering

Hvordan fikse “Fatal feil arduinoble.h ingen slik fil eller katalog ”i Arduino -programmering
Arduino er et mikrokontrollerbasert utviklingsmiljø brukt til programmering og maskinvarekontroll. Den har et brukervennlig programvareutviklingsmiljø som lar brukere skrive, samle og laste opp kode til Arduino-styret. Noen ganger kan imidlertid brukere møte en feil som sier: "Fatal feil: Arduinoble.H: Ingen slik fil eller katalog“. Denne feilen kan forhindre at brukeren laster opp koden til Arduino -styret.

Denne artikkelen belyser årsakene til denne feilen og gir deg noen effektive løsninger for å fikse den.

Hva er arduinble.h

Arduinble.H er en overskriftsfil i Arduinoble -biblioteket som gir funksjoner for å jobbe med Bluetooth Low Energy (BLE) periferiutstyr. BLE er en trådløs kommunikasjonsprotokoll som ofte brukes i IoT (Internet of Things) enheter.

Arduinoble Library forenkler prosessen med å jobbe med ble periferiutstyr på Arduino -brett. Det gir et sett med funksjoner som lar deg oppdage, koble til og kommunisere med BLE -enheter over en Bluetooth -tilkobling.

Arduinoble er kompatibel med en rekke Arduino -brett, inkludert Arduino Nano 33 BLE, Arduino Nano 33 IoT, Arduino MKR WiFi 1010, og Arduino Nano 33 Sense.

Hva er årsaker til “Fatal feil: Arduinble.H: Ingen slik fil eller katalog "-feil

Den "dødelige feilen: arduinble.H: Ingen slik fil eller katalog ”Feilmelding oppstår når Arduino IDE ikke finner Arduinoble Library. Noen hovedårsaker for denne feilen inkluderer:

  • Arduinoble Library er ikke installert
  • Feil bibliotekinstallasjon
  • Feil tavleutvalg
  • Utgave av filplassering
  • Headerfil mangler
  1. Arduinoble -biblioteket er ikke installert: Hvis du ikke har installert Arduinoble Library, vil Arduino IDE ikke kunne finne Arduinoble.H headerfil.
  2. Feil bibliotekinstallasjon: Hvis du har installert Arduinoble -biblioteket feil, kan det hende at Arduino IDE ikke kan finne Arduinble.H headerfil.
  3. Utdatert Arduino Ide: Hvis du bruker en utdatert versjon av Arduino IDE, kan det hende at den ikke kan finne Arduinoble.H headerfil.
  4. Feil tavleutvalg: Hvis du har valgt feil brett i Arduino IDE, kan det hende at det ikke er kompatibelt med Arduinoble -biblioteket, noe.H: Ingen slik fil eller katalog "Feilmelding.
  5. Utgave av filplassering: Denne feilen kan også være forårsaket av et filplasseringsproblem. Hvis Arduino IDE ikke er i stand til å finne Arduinble.H -fil, den vil vise denne feilen. Det kan oppstå når filen ikke er i riktig mappe eller ikke er navngitt riktig.
  6. Headerfil mangler: En av hovedårsakene til at denne feilen oppstår er på grunn av en manglende overskriftsfil. Siden kode kontinuerlig ringer bibliotekfunksjoner og på grunn av ingen overskriftsfiler oppstår denne feilen.

Hvordan fikse “Fatal feil: Arduinble.H: Ingen slik fil eller katalog "-feil

Nå som vi kjenner årsakene til den “dødelige feilen: Arduinble.H: Ingen slik fil eller katalog "Feilmelding, la oss utforske noen løsninger på dette problemet:

  • Installer Arduinoble Library
  • Oppdater Arduino IDE
  • Sjekk filplassen
  • Inkluder Arduinoble Header -filen

1: Installer Arduinoble Library

Den første og mest åpenbare løsningen er å installere Arduinoble Library. For å gjøre dette, åpne Arduino IDE, naviger til Skisse> Inkluder bibliotek> Administrer biblioteker, og søk etter "arduinoble".

Når du har funnet biblioteket, klikker du på installasjon.

Du kan også laste ned Arduinoble -biblioteket i ZIP -filen og installere den ved hjelp av inkluderer biblioteket i Arduino IDE. For å laste ned Arduinoble -biblioteket, klikker du på Arduinble Zip Library:

Etter å ha lastet ned zip -biblioteket klikk Skisse> Inkluder bibliotek> Legg til .Zip Library. Velg deretter ZIP -filen og klikk Åpne:

2: Oppdater Arduino IDE

Noen ganger kan denne feilen oppstå på grunn av en utdatert versjon av Arduino IDE. For å fikse dette, bør du oppdatere Arduino IDE til en oppdatert versjon. Last ned oppdatert versjon fra Arduino offisielle nettsted.

3: Sjekk filplassen

Hvis løsningene ovenfor ikke fungerer, bør du sjekke filplassen. Forsikre deg om at Arduinoble.H -filen er i riktig mappe og heter riktig.

For å sjekke Arduinoble Installation, gå til mappen:

C: \ Brukere \ [Brukernavn] \ Dokumenter \ Arduino \ Libraries

Her vil du se Arduinoble Name -mappen hvis den er riktig installert:

4: Ta med Arduinoble Header -filen

Man må sjekke at Arduinoble.H -overskriftsfilen er inkludert i koden. Inkludert overskriftsfilen kan løse denne feilen mesteparten av tiden. Oppdater Arduino BLE -biblioteket og ta med overskriftsfilen. Dette vil løse problemet.

Konklusjon

Arduinble.H er en overskriftsfil som lar Arduino -tavler kommunisere med Bluetooth -enheter med lav energi som smartklokker og medisinsk utstyr. Her undersøkte vi årsakene bak denne feilen og ga deg noen effektive løsninger for å fikse den. Husk å alltid sjekke om Arduinoble -biblioteket er riktig installert, og om filstien er riktig. Med disse tipsene kan du enkelt fikse denne feilen og kan designe ethvert prosjekt med Bluetooth.